Item 7.01. Regulation FD Disclosure.

Also on June 13, 2007, the Company reported 2007 same-store sales results for stores open for one full year. Same store gasoline gallons sold decreased 0.2% in May 2007 compared to May 2006. The gasoline margin was above the Company’s fiscal 2007 goal of 10.8 cents per gallon. The average retail price of gasoline sold during May 2007 was $3.13 per gallon. Same-store sales of grocery and other merchandise increased 9.9% and prepared food and fountain same-store sales increased 8.1% in May 2007 compared to May 2006.

Item 8.01. Other Information.

On May 30, 2007, a complaint was filed in the United States District Court for the Northern District of Iowa by two former employees against the Company, in which the claim is made that Casey’s failed to properly pay overtime compensation to two or more of its assistant managers. Specifically, plaintiffs claim that the assistant managers were treated as non-exempt employees entitled to overtime pay, but that the Company failed to properly record all hours worked and failed to pay the assistant managers overtime pay for all hours worked in excess of 40 per week. The action purports to be a collective action under the Fair Labor Standards Act (essentially equivalent to a class action) brought on behalf of all “persons who are currently or were employed during the three-year period immediately preceding the filing of [the] complaint as “Assistant Managers” at any Casey’s General Store operated by Defendant (directly or through one of its wholly owned subsidiaries), who worked overtime during any given week within that period and who have not filed a complaint to recover overtime wages.” The complaint seeks relief in the form of back wages owed all members of the “class” during the three-year period preceding the filing of the complaint, liquidated damages, attorneys fees and costs. Management does not believe the Company is liable to the plaintiffs for the conduct complained of, and intends to contest the matter vigorously.
